Welche arten von apis gibt es?

Gefragt von: Isabell Böttcher  |  Letzte Aktualisierung: 3. Oktober 2021
sternezahl: 4.3/5 (21 sternebewertungen)

Welche Arten von APIs gibt es?
  • Funktionsorientierte APIs.
  • Dateiorientierte APIs.
  • Protokollorientierte APIs.
  • Objektorientierte APIs.

Wie funktioniert ein API?

Einfach ausgedrückt funktioniert eine API wie ein virtueller Mittelsmann, der Informationen von einer Schnittstelle – etwa einer Mobil-App – an eine andere weiterleitet. APIs verbinden verschiedene Teile einer Softwareplattform mit dem Ziel, dass Informationen am richtigen Ort landen.

Was ist ein API Typ?

Die Anwendungsprogrammierstelle (API, Application Programming Interface) von WLM ermöglicht Anwendungen Folgendes: ... Namen und Merkmale der vorhandenen Klassen einer bestimmten WLM-Konfiguration abfragen (wlm_read_classes)

Welche Vorteile bietet das application programming interface des Kernels für die einzelnen Programme?

Vorteile durch die Verwendung von Programmierschnittstellen

Komplexe und sehr große Software lässt sich durch APIs modularisieren und dadurch vereinfachen. Einzelne Funktionen können in Programmmodule ausgelagert werden, wodurch sich eine saubere Gesamtstruktur ergibt.

Wie funktioniert eine Schnittstelle?

Allgemein gesagt ist eine Schnittstelle eine Verbindung zwischen zwei Systemen, die eine Kommunikation bzw. eine Übertragung ermöglicht. ... Sie ermöglichen eine Kommunikation sowohl zwischen Software- als auch Hardwarekomponenten.

Was ist eine API?

22 verwandte Fragen gefunden

Wie beschreibt man eine Schnittstelle?

Eine Schnittstelle wird durch eine Menge von Regeln beschrieben, der Schnittstellenbeschreibung. Neben der Beschreibung, welche Funktionen vorhanden sind und wie sie benutzt werden, gehört zu der Schnittstellenbeschreibung auch ein sogenannter Kontrakt, der die Semantik der einzelnen Funktionen beschreibt.

Was ist eine Schnittstelle programmieren?

Eine Programmierschnittstelle (auch Anwendungsschnittstelle, genauer Schnittstelle zur Programmierung von Anwendungen), häufig nur kurz API genannt (von englisch application programming interface, wörtlich ‚Anwendungsprogrammierschnittstelle'), ist ein Programmteil, der von einem Softwaresystem anderen Programmen zur ...

Wie viele APIs gibt es?

Welche Arten von APIs gibt es? Es gibt grundsätzlich vier verschiedene Klassen von Programmierschnittstellen: Funktionsorientierte APIs. Dateiorientierte APIs.

Was bringt eine API?

(Application Programming Interface) – Definition und Vorteile. Programmierschnittstellen (kurz APIs) erleichtern milliardenfach pro Tag den Datentransfer zwischen Systemen und dienen als wichtige Zugangspunkte, die Unternehmen mit Kunden, Auftragnehmern und Mitarbeitern verbinden.

Was ist API einfach erklärt?

API ist die Abkürzung für "Application Programming Interface". ... Beim Programmieren vereinheitlichen APIs die Datenübergabe zwischen Programmteilen, etwa Modulen, und Programmen. Komplexe Programme kommen ohne APIs nicht mehr aus. Dabei werden einzelne Programmteile, sogenannte Module, vom eigentlichen Code abgekapselt.

Was ist eine API Abfrage?

Die API (Application Programming Interface) der Wiki-Projekte erlaubt die Abfrage von Informationen über Projekte oder Seiten, die auch automatisiert durch Software abgerufen und verarbeitet werden können; sowie automatisierte Bearbeitung von Seiten.

Was ist ein API Zugriff?

Die Enlighten-API (Application Programming Interface) ermöglicht es mobilen Apps, Tools zum Gebäudemanagement und anderen Anwendungen, die Systemleistungsdaten von Enlighten abzurufen und zu nutzen. ... eine Anwendung fordert API-Zugriff vom Anlageneigentümer an. der Anlageneigentümer gewährt der Anwendung API-Zugriff.

Was ist ein API Request?

API steht für Application Programming Interface. Mit ihr können Produkte oder Services unabhängig von ihrer Implementierung untereinander kommunizieren. Auf diese Weise lässt sich die Anwendungsentwicklung optimieren, was wiederum Zeit und Geld spart.

Wie funktioniert eine Web API?

Eine API ermöglicht es, Daten zwischen Software und Programmteilen auszutauschen. Dies erfolgt nach einer vorab festgelegten Struktur. ... Jeder Programmteil, der mittels Application Programming Interface angebunden wird, ist von der restlichen Anwendung getrennt.

Wie erstelle ich eine API?

So erstellst du einen API-Schlüssel:
  1. Rufe Google Maps Platform > Anmeldedaten auf. Zur Seite „Anmeldedaten“
  2. Klicke auf der Seite Anmeldedaten auf Anmeldedaten erstellen > API-Schlüssel. Im Dialogfeld API-Schlüssel erstellt wird der neu erstellte API-Schlüssel angezeigt.
  3. Klicke auf Schließen.

Wie greift man auf eine API zu?

Wie funktioniert eine API? Wenn eine neue App erstellt wird, muss man diese oft beim Betreiber der API registrieren. So muss zum Beispiel jede Facebook App einen eigenen API-Key, also einen Authentifizierungsschlüssel, beantragen. Dieser API-Key wird bei jeder Anfrage an den API-Server übertragen.

Was ist Apis c30?

Wann wird Apis mellifica eingesetzt? Apis mellifica ist eine homöopathische Arznei, die aus dem Körper von Bienen basiert. Es wird zur Behandlung von akuten Entzündungszuständen von Haut und Schleimhäuten eingesetzt. In solchen Fällen zeigen sich die typischen Entzündungszeichen wie starke Schwellung sowie Rötung.

Was ist ein API Server?

Der API-Server stellt eine REST-Schnittstelle zur Verfügung, die von Dritt-Applikationen verwendet werden kann. ... Die REST-Services werden anhand kundenspezifischer Anforderungen konfiguriert und können flexibel erweitert werden. Die Übertragung der Daten erfolgt wahlweise mittels HTTP oder HTTPS.

Was versteht man unter einer Schnittstelle?

Ein Interface (englisch für „Schnittstelle") bezeichnet eine Übergangsstelle zwischen verschiedenen Komponenten eines IT-Systems, über die der Datenaustausch oder die Datenverarbeitung realisiert werden. Dies können Mensch-Computer-Schnittstellen oder Computer-Computer-Schnittstellen sein.

Was ist ein Interface programmieren?

Eine Schnittstelle (englisch interface) gibt in der objektorientierten Programmierung an, welche Methoden in den unterschiedlichen Klassen vorhanden sind oder vorhanden sein müssen.

Was für Schnittstellen gibt es?

Inhaltsverzeichnis
  • Schnittstellen ermöglichen Datenübertragung zwischen Rechner und externen Geräten.
  • Serielle und parallele Schnittstellen.
  • USB.
  • PS/2.
  • Thunderbolt.
  • Bluetooth.
  • Firewire.
  • VGA.

Was ist Kundeninterface?

Bei Software ist mit der Benutzerschnittstelle häufig die grafische Oberfläche einer Anwendung gemeint, auch Graphical User Interface bzw. GUI. Die Funktionen und Ergebnisse eines Programms werden grafisch dargestellt, sodass Benutzer möglichst einfach damit arbeiten können.

Was versteht man unter Schnittstellenmanagement?

Das Schnittstellenmanagement versucht, die Probleme, die durch Schnittstellen entstehen, zu vermeiden und einen möglichst reibungslosen Ablauf der Prozesse zu gewährleisten. Schnittstellen = durch Arbeitsteilung entstandene Transferpunkte zwischen Funktionsbereichen, Sparten, Projekten, Personen, Unternehmen, etc.

Was ist die Grundfunktion einer Schnittstelle?

Eine Schnittstelle verbindet Systeme, die unterschiedliche physikalische, elektrische und mechanische Eigenschaften besitzen. In jedem elektronischen System sind definierte Schnittstellen eine Voraussetzung für die Interoperabilität mit anderen Systemen, Geräten und Baugruppen.

Warum RESTful API?

Die REST-API ist aufgrund ihrer Flexibilität, Schnelligkeit und Einfachheit eine der beliebtesten Varianten, um Daten aus dem Internet zu bekommen. Bis zum Jahr 2000 war SOAP (Simple Object Access Protocol), das von Microsoft entwickelt wurde, die am weitesten verbreitete Plattform für Client-Server-Interaktionen.